Tools Needed
- Pan
- Bowl
- Spatula
- Grater
- Knife
- Cutting board
Ingredients
- Shrimp: 200g
- Chives
- Salt: 1/2 teaspoon
- MSG: 1/2 teaspoon
- Sugar: 1/2 teaspoon
- Cooking oil
- Pork fat
- Shallots
- Pancake flour: 500g
- Crispy fried flour: 500g
- Coconut milk: 1 liter
- Shredded coconut: 500g
- Fresh mint
- Mushrooms (optional)
- Rice paper
- Fish sauce: 100ml
- Sugar (for fish sauce): 100g
- MSG (for fish sauce): 1 small spoon
- Fresh coconut water (for fish sauce): 300ml
- Garlic
- Chili
- Lemon
- Carrots (optional)
Step-by-Step Instructions
Step 1. Prepare Ingredients & Marinate
- Marinate shrimp with salt, MSG, sugar, and cooking oil for 30 minutes.

Step 2. Cook Shrimp & Make Dipping Sauce
- Stir-fry shrimp with pork fat and shallots until cooked.
- Combine sugar, MSG, coconut water, and fish sauce; boil and cool.


Step 3. Make the Shrimp & Chive Pancakes
- Combine pancake flour, crispy fried flour, coconut milk, and fresh mint.
- Add chives to the batter.
- Heat pan with lard, pour batter to make pancakes.
- Cook pancakes over low heat to prevent burning.




Step 4. Serve & Enjoy!
- Serve pancakes with fried shrimp, optional vegetables, and dipping sauce.

Tips
- For crispier pancakes, use more lard and cook on higher heat.
- Adjust the amount of shredded coconut in the batter for desired fat content.
- Add optional fillings like mushrooms to the pancake batter.
- Prepare the fish sauce ahead of time and store it in the refrigerator for up to two weeks.
- To make the dipping sauce, pound garlic and chili, squeeze lemon, and mix with the fish sauce.

FAQs
1. Can I substitute the shrimp?
Yes! You can use other seafood like scallops or prawns, or even shredded chicken or pork for a different flavor profile.
2. How do I make the pancakes crispy?
Use a good quality oil with a high smoke point, and ensure your pan is hot enough before adding the batter. Don't overcrowd the pan.
